  • Abstract
    The peer-to-peer paradigm is used in more and more advanced applications. One of the next areas that promise a success for the P2P paradigm lies in the upcoming trend of social networks. However, several security issues have to be solved in P2P-based social network platforms. We present in this paper a practical solution that establishes a trust infrastructure, enables authenticated and secure communication between users in the social network and provides personalized, fine grained data access control. We implemented our solution in a P2P based platform for social networks and show that the solution is practical and lightweight both in time consumption and traffic overhead.
